But how do they differ? Well, the secret sauce lies in their chemical structures. You see, delta 8 THC has a double bond on the 8th carbon atom in its chain, hence the name. Delta 9, on the other hand, sports a double bond on the 9th carbon atom. It might sound like a tiny tweak, but it results in some pretty distinct effects.

The delta 8 THC molecule interacts with your body’s endocannabinoid system, which is like your own personal cannabis reception system. When you consume delta 8 weed, it binds to your CB1 receptors, which are scattered throughout your brain and central nervous system. This binding triggers a cascade of effects, leading to that blissful, euphoric sensation without pushing you into the deep end of the psychedelic pool.

Delta 8 weed finds itself navigating through a patchwork of state and federal regulations that can be as confusing as trying to fold a fitted sheet.

On the federal stage, things got a bit clearer in 2020 with the passage of the Farm Bill. This bill gave the green light (pun intended) for the cultivation and sale of hemp-derived products, including delta 8 THC, as long as they contain less than 0.3% delta 9 THC. So, in the eyes of Uncle Sam, delta 8 weed can be the law-abiding citizen of the cannabinoid world if it stays within that 0.3% limit.

However, it’s not all sunshine and rainbows because the story takes a twist when you zoom in on individual states. Some states have embraced delta 8 with open arms, allowing it to dance its way into the market, while others have put on the brakes and said, “Not in our backyard!” This means the legal status of delta 8 weed can be a real head-scratcher depending on where you call home.

Safety and Side Effects: Navigating the Delta 8 Journey

So, you’re ready to hop on the delta 8 weed train, but before we set off, it’s crucial to have a chat about safety and side effects. Think of this as the seatbelt talk before a wild rollercoaster ride. Safety first, always!

The Safety Lowdown

Delta 8 weed is often praised for its gentler approach to the high, but like any journey, it’s not without its twists and turns. Here’s what you need to keep in mind to ensure a safe ride:

Start Low, Go Slow: The golden rule of delta 8 THC is to begin with a low dose and give it time to kick in. It can take longer to feel the effects compared to other methods, so don’t be hasty. Slow and steady wins the race!

Stay Hydrated: Delta 8 weed might leave you feeling a bit parched, so keep a glass of water handy. Hydration is key to prevent any dry mouth sensations, aka the infamous “cottonmouth.”

Know Your Source: Ensure you’re getting your delta 8 products from reputable sources. Quality matters, and you want to be certain you’re not getting any unexpected surprises in your weed journey.

Mixing and Matching: Be cautious about combining delta 8 with alcohol or other substances. Mixing can lead to unpredictable effects, and not the good kind of unpredictability.

The Side Effect Shuffle

Now, let’s talk about the dance floor where side effects make their entrance. Delta 8 weed is generally well-tolerated, but it’s essential to be aware of potential side effects:

Mild and Manageable: Some users might experience mild side effects like dry eyes, dizziness, or an increased heart rate. These are typically short-lived and can often be managed with a sip of water and a change of scenery.

Dosage Matters: Taking too much delta 8 weed can lead to intensified side effects, like anxiety or paranoia. Remember the “start low, go slow” mantra to keep your journey on the right track.

Individual Variations: Keep in mind that how you react to delta 8 THC can differ from the person sitting next to you. We’re all unique, and what’s a smooth ride for one may feel bumpier for another.

Avoidance Alert: If you have a history of anxiety, panic disorders, or certain medical conditions, it’s wise to consult with a healthcare professional before embarking on your delta 8 adventure.

How to Consume Delta 8 Weed: Picking Your Adventure Path

Now that you’ve got the scoop on delta 8 weed and its potential benefits, it’s time to decide how you want to embark on your adventure. Think of this as choosing your own adventure, but with different ways to enjoy your delta 8 experience. So, which path will you take?

1. The Vaping Voyage

Picture yourself with a sleek vape pen in hand, ready to take a puff of delta 8 goodness. Vaping is a popular and convenient way to enjoy delta 8 weed. The vaporization process allows for quick absorption, giving you a faster ticket to the high you’re seeking. Plus, it’s discreet and doesn’t involve any burning, so you won’t be producing clouds of smoke.

2. The Edible Excursion

If you’re more of a “slow and steady wins the race” type, edibles might be your jam. Delta 8 THC-infused edibles come in various forms, from gummies to chocolates to cookies. The catch here is that they take longer to kick in—sometimes up to an hour or more. But once they do, you’re in for a gradual and prolonged experience that can last for hours.

3. The Tincture Trail

Tinctures are like the Swiss Army knives of delta 8 weed consumption. These liquid extracts allow you to get creative with your dosing. A few drops under the tongue, and you’re on your way to a tailored delta 8 experience. They’re known for their flexibility and relatively quick onset.

4. The Topical Trek

For those looking to target specific areas of the body without the buzz, delta 8 topicals are a fantastic option. These creams, balms, and lotions are applied directly to the skin, providing potential relief from localized pain or discomfort. No need to worry about getting high on this journey—it’s all about soothing the body.

5. The Capsule Quest

Imagine a world where taking your delta 8 THC is as simple as swallowing a pill. Well, you don’t have to imagine it because delta 8 capsules exist! They offer a precise and discreet way to enjoy the benefits without any fuss.

6. The Flower Frolic

For those who prefer the classic approach, delta 8 weed is also available in its natural flower form. This is essentially delta 8-infused hemp flower that can be smoked or vaporized, just like traditional cannabis. It’s the closest you’ll get to the genuine plant experience.

7. The Beverage Bliss

If you’re the kind of person who enjoys sipping on a beverage while winding down, delta 8-infused drinks might be your go-to. These can include everything from teas and coffees to fruit juices. They offer a tasty and refreshing way to indulge in your delta 8 adventure.
